Output 468770e9ae1075306b25cbe29e79ad203f597ab03daaf7212e8c33e25c8b0026:1

value
33084654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df952b7b2c5198c757bfa4cc5c3a125d171ba9b2 OP_EQUAL
address
3N5DJpnXKc44E8XqngiRZ3aDbdhSwye7Zy
transaction
468770e9ae1075306b25cbe29e79ad203f597ab03daaf7212e8c33e25c8b0026
confirmations
327121
spent
true